Techman Robot worked with precision mechanism manufacturer Jinpao Precision to implement a large-scale automation project using collaborative robots. Jinpao Precision produces precision metal components for industries including aerospace, communications, medical, and automation equipment. The initiative focuses on supporting the company’s high-mix, low-volume production model, where frequent product changes require flexible manufacturing systems.

The deployment uses Techman Robot’s built-in vision technology, which integrates visual recognition directly with the robot arm. This setup allows the cobots to identify parts and adjust to workpieces of different sizes and shapes without requiring external camera systems. Jinpao Precision uses the system for operations such as screw fastening, rivet hole punching, and tolerance inspection, while also supporting automated quality inspection during production and reducing setup time during line changes.

The rollout spans ten manufacturing processes across Jinpao Precision’s production lines, including fastening, riveting, stamping, spray painting, and spot welding. Project data shows the automation program freed up approximately 80,000 hours of annual human labor. After training, Jinpao Precision’s internal automation team replicated eight automated stations on a server assembly line within one month.
